On August 24, 1992, Hurricane Andrew struck Miami with losses that had never been seen in America before.  Andrew caused most carrier to stop writing property coverage in the state and a state pool the Florida Joint Underwriting Association FJUA (now known as Citizens) was formed to provide coverage for Florida homeowners.  A special hurricane wind deductible percentage was established forcing Florida homeowners to participate in future losses.  It was believed that adding a wind percentage deductible would give the FJUA stability and attract private carriers back to the state.  So how exactly does a wind deductible work?

The wind deductible is a percentage–typically 2, 5 and 10 percent–of coverage A which is the insured Dwelling value.  For example a 100,000 coverage “A” policy with a 10% wind deductible has a 10,000 deductible.  These Deductibles are annual so that if you experience more than one loss in a year you are only assessed the deductible one time.  The wind deductible is assessed when your home is damaged by a named storm/hurricane.  Additionally some carriers have a deductible called “Other Wind” which refers to a non-named storm deductible.  For any other type of covered loss on your policy you will have what is called an “All Other Peril” deductible and this number traditionally is a dollar amount 500, 1000, 2500 or more.

When shopping for hurricane coverage it is important to note that there are minimal savings in increasing a wind deductible on your policy.  The best way to shop for coverage is to receive quotes from multiple carriers as prices vary significantly.  Additionally some carriers give money saving perks such as disappearing wind deductibles.  A disappearing deductible is given to clients with no wind claims for 5 years or more and are free perks.

Home Insurance in Florida is a significant investment knowing your deductible options is important as we head into Hurricane season.

Mortgage insurance does not protect you personally or insure your home, yet it insures the bank if you default on your loan. Homeowners insurance provides coverage for you and your home in the event of an unexpected loss.

What does homeowners insurance cover?

  • Property Damage
  • Natural Disasters
  • Standard Home Liability
  • Extra Money for Living
  • Personal Property Coverage (personal belongings)

Cost Factors

  • Value of your home
  • Crime rate in the area surrounding your home
  • Amount of prior claims
  • The state in which you live

5 Things You Must Know Regarding Homeowners Insurance

  • Decide what kind of coverage is best for YOU
  • Understand Actual Cost Value and Replacement Cost Value
  • Determine if you want more liability and medical coverage
  • Take advantage of the discounting options
  • Flood insurance is not included and is usually purchased separately

As a counterpart of Black Friday and Cyber Monday is Small Business Saturday. This shopping day is held the first Saturday after Thanksgiving.  First observed in 2010 it was a way to promote and support our local small business owners.  Nationally 1 in 5 small businesses are owned by families, people just like you and I. According to the Small Business Administration, small businesses accounted for 63 percent of the net share of new jobs over the past six years. 48% of all people employed in America work for small businesses.  Supporting your local small business is a great way to insure future jobs in your community.  As a small business owner myself for over 25 years, I understand the importance of referrals from friends, family and the community.  For this reason, I would like to promote a few of our local business partners and friends.  Here are some creative holiday gift ideas.

You’re on a trip and rent a car, does your auto policy cover you? https://tritonagency.com/2018/11/13/youre-on-a-trip-and-rent-a-car-does-your-auto-policy-cover-you/ Tue, 13 Nov 2018 17:21:57 +0000 https://tritonagency.com/?p=1137 The answer is yes and no.  We often get calls from clients at the rental car counter asking if they should purchase or waive the coverage offered by the rental car company.  So what is the correct answer and what is the cheapest way to get insured?  Personal Auto Insurance coverage extends to vehicles you ... The answer is yes and no.  We often get calls from clients at the rental car counter asking if they should purchase or waive the coverage offered by the rental car company.  So what is the correct answer and what is the cheapest way to get insured?  Personal Auto Insurance coverage extends to vehicles you borrow and rent.  The Insurance extended to you by your carrier is the coverage listed on your policy declarations page.  Liability, PIP and Uninsured Motorist will extend to the rental vehicle as may the Physical Damage, remember that you will be responsible for any deductibles on the policy.  The issue with renting a car is in your policy limitations.  If you do not have certain coverage or have low limits you may be left with a shortfall.  Another problem in renting a vehicle is the “loss of use”.  If you are involved in an accident with a rental vehicle that company is entitled to the daily rental rate while that vehicle is being repaired.  Loss of use is not covered by any auto policy.  Fortunately, some credit card companies do offer “loss of use” coverage if you use their credit card to rent the vehicle (always check with your credit card companies first).

Thus the cheapest way overall to rent a vehicle is to ask your credit card company what Insurance they include and make sure your primary auto policy covers you for Liability and physical damage.  If you have all these bases covered you can consider waiving coverage.  Always check with a licensed agent first before waiving any Insurance.

Safe travels.

For years I have been asked by clients this question and for years the answer is the same “maybe”. While most reputable Health Carriers choose to Coordinate Benefits with Auto Insurance some simply exclude Auto Injury all together. For those who have health policies with Auto Exclusions, it is important to maximize your Medical and Uninsured Motorist coverage in the event of a loss. Medical payments and Uninsured Motorist are intended to cover your medical expenses when injured in an accident. You can also maximize the Uninsured Motorist (UM) coverage by purchasing an Umbrella which includes UM. The national average medical cost for non-fatal injury from auto-related accidents is approximately $60,000. I suggest you read your health insurance summary of benefits. Mine was 245 pages so I decided to use the find function on my computer. I was able to quickly find the Auto related limitations.

If your carrier coordinates benefits with Auto Insurance here is how that works. In an auto accident, your auto insurance is primary coverage, any deficit in payment would fall to your Health Carrier. Your Health Carrier would then review what has been paid by the Auto Carrier in order to determine if you have any benefit left. This means that if your Auto Carrier paid the max that your Health Carrier would have been responsible for they could deny any additional payment. Pretty complicated right? Yes, this is why I always recommend that clients carry Uninsured Motorist to eliminate gaps. We are all unfortunately subject to our plan deductibles and limitations. Uninsured Motorist coverage has very few limitations and could make you whole after an accident.

Always read the fine print and get the advice of a licensed agent when deciding what coverage to purchase.
